UNC Rural Obstetrics & Gynecology Fellowship Join the Nation's First Rural OB/GYN Fellowship - Make a Real Impact in Underserved Communities

About the Program

The UNC School of Medicine proudly announces a two-year UNC Rural Obstetrics & Gynecology Fellowship, the first of its kind in the nation, training physician leaders to deliver exceptional women's healthcare in rural maternal health.

Fellowship Highlights

  • 50% Clinical Practice: Provide comprehensive, full-scope OB/GYN practice under the guidance of skilled clinical partners at a single fellowship site at UNC Health Rockingham in Eden or UNCHealth Lenoir in Kinston.
  • 50% Training & Mentorship: Fellows will have an identified primary mentor to help chart a roadmap for their 2 years of career development. Options can include completing a Master-level degree (e.g. MSCR) or tailored coursework in QI/QA, community engagement, leadership, healthcare finances, equity, etc. They will have the ability to join state-wide initiatives to improve maternal health, receive research training to study rural health outcomes, or lead QI/QA projects directly informed by their clinical practice.

UNC Health Kinston Fellowship Site Highlights

UNC Health Complete Care, located in Kinston, NC provides excellent care for women of all ages. OB/GYNs provide maternity care and a full range of gynecologic care, from routine checkups and screenings to minimally invasive surgeries.
